Default O2 Xphone II vs Motorola MPX220

How will you compare O2 Xphone II to Motorola MPX220? :roll:

I believe the XPhoneII is the same as the Audiovox SMT5600 and I-Mate SP3 phone. There's plenty of reviews out there for those. For the most part, the two phones are comparable in quality. It's just whether you want a flip-phone or not. Personally, I don't trust anything that motorola makes (they have a horrible reputation for phones with bad firmware and/or hardware problems).

Also, I believe that the XPhoneII has Smartphone 2003 software and the Motorola has Smartphone 2002 software.

Actually, I think the XPhoneII is the same as the E200.

Oh, and the Moto 220 has WM 2003, which is the same as the E200. While the SMT 5600 has WM 2003 SE.
